Mannose-binding lectin-associated serine protease-1 and -3 (Masp 1/3) deficient mice fail convert pro-complement factor D in its active form. Mannose-binding lectin-associated serine protease-1 converts pro-complement factor D in vitro indicating that mannose-binding lectin-associated serine protease-1 (MASP-1) is an essential protease for activating complement factor D 709321 3.4.21.46 proteolytic modification profactor D 36585
